Facebook all set to acquire WhatsApp for a staggering $19 billion

 Facebook all set to acquire WhatsApp for a staggering $19 billion

As per the latest reports, Facebook founder Mark Zuckerberg has publicly announced that they are all set to rope WhatsApp into their team at a stipulated price of $19 billion out of which $16 billion will be paid in cash while the remaining will be in the form of stocks.
Apparently, many keen observers of Silicon Valley are stunned with this new acquisition especially because of the hefty price tag that it carries. Presently, WhatsApp has a user base of over 450 million people from all corners of the world out of which a majority are young people. Messaging has always been an indispensable utility especially in the era of mobile technology which is one of the primary reasons why Facebook has always been keen to rope WhatsApp into its squad. WhatsApp will be assisted by Morgan Stanley for the deal whereas Facebook will be advised by Allen & Co.
